We are seeking grants to develop a modification to Air Cooled normally aspirated Lycoming and potentially Continental Engines. Funding would go to prototyping an engine, testing it and providing data on improvements in SFC, Power and Reliability. Conservative calculation of potential are: - 18% Reduction in Fuel Flow for same power points. Ex. IO-360 at 75% power burning 10GPH would go to 8GPH - 60% or more increase in power with the same packaging as a normally aspirated engine at the same RPM - We expect significant reduction in oil consumption and longer durations between oil changes - If certified we see the the potential of TBO to go to 3000 hrs - Will test for reliability (Long Term Test)
Other testing with different grades of Fuel from Auto Gas, Jet A, Diesel.
Benefits:
- More Range - More Power - Higher Service Ceiling - Safer - Reduction in Maintenance Cost - Multi-Fuels Usage (Elimination of LL Low Lead)
